Mogg’s Wood
Mogg’s Wood is a forest in Wraxall and Failand, North Somerset, England. Mogg’s Wood is situated nearby to the hamlet West Hill, as well as near the village Wraxall.Places of Interest

Noah’s Ark Zoo Farm
Zoo
Noah's Ark Zoo Farm is a 100-acre zoo developed on a working farm in Wraxall, North Somerset, 6 miles west of Bristol, England. It is home to the largest elephant facility in northern Europe.

Elms colliery
Archaeological site
Photo: Neil Owen, CC BY-SA 2.0.
Elms Colliery is a disused coal mine in Nailsea within the English County of Somerset. It has been scheduled as an ancient monument and placed on the Heritage at Risk Register due to the risk of vandalism and further decay.

Portishead
Photo: Wikimedia, CC BY-SA 2.0.
Portishead is a large port town in Somerset with a population of about 25,000. Historically a fishing port, it underwent rapid expansion during the 19th century when it became a hub for chemical industry.
